Bim Son cement plant gets listed
Bim Son Cement Joint Stock Company on Nov. 24 listed more than 90 million shares on the Hanoi Securities Trading Centre under the code BCC.

Taiwan Cement to Inject more in Mainland China reinvestments
The Investment Commission under the Ministry of Economic Affairs (MOEA) approved Taiwan Cement Corp to invest US$33.2m in the mainland China on cement plant located at Yingde of Guangdong province.
Egypt’s Amreya Cement 9-mth profit jumps 56 per cent
Egypt’s Amreya Cement reported net profit of E£201.8m (EUR35.3m) for the first nine months of 2006, a 56 per cent increase, the stock exchange said on Thursday.

Chia Hsin eager to cement place in Top-10
Hong Kong-listed Chia Hsin Cement Greater China seeks to boost its annual production capacity to about 10Mt in a couple of years and to 30Mt by 2016.

Lafarge Malayan Cement returns to profit
Lafarge Malayan has recorded a nine-month pre-tax profit of RM138.688m (US$38m) against a loss of RM26.237m a year ago as it benefits from firmer domestic and higher export prices

Profit drops 31% at Egypt’s National Cement in Q1
Egypt’s National Cement reported a 31 per cent drop in net profit to E£106m (US$18.5m) for its fiscal first quarter ended September, the stock exchange said on Sunday.
Alexandria Cement 9-mth net profit down 24 per cent
Egypt’s Alexandria Cement reported a 24 per cent drop in nine-month net profit to E£136m (US$23.8m), the stock exchange said on Thursday.

Holcim acquires additional stake in GACL
Holcim has reportedly acquired a 3.7 stake per cent in Indian cement maker Gujarat Ambuja Cements Ltd. to add to its existing 15.6 per cent holding, a source close to the deal said on Thursday.
Buzzi Unicem improves financial ratios
Buzzi Unicem’s turnover rose by 8.3% to EUR2,378.4m, with margins widening from 26.8% to 28.7% as the EBITDA improved by 15.7% to EUR681.9m
